People Score in 07512, Totowa, New Jersey

The People Score for the Lung Cancer Score in 07512, Totowa, New Jersey is 46 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 94.52 percent of the residents in 07512 has some form of health insurance. 25.51 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 81.08 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 07512 would have to travel an average of 5.21 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, St Mary's General Hospital. In a 20-mile radius, there are 1,554 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 07512, Totowa, New Jersey.

**The Lung Cancer Score: A Hypothetical Assessment**

While we can't assign a definitive "Lung Cancer Score" to 07512 without extensive data analysis, we can assess the factors that contribute to risk and resilience.

**Factors that potentially *increase* risk:**

* **Smoking rates:** While data specific to 07512 is needed, the prevalence of smoking within the community is a significant factor.
* **Exposure to environmental pollutants:** Proximity to roadways and industrial areas could increase exposure to air pollutants.
* **Age of the population:** An aging population may have a higher prevalence of lung cancer due to past exposures and cumulative risk.
* **Socioeconomic factors:** Access to healthcare, healthy food, and other resources can be influenced by socioeconomic status.

**Factors that potentially *decrease* risk and increase resilience:**

* **Strong community ties:** A supportive community can promote healthy behaviors and provide access to resources.
* **Access to healthcare:** Availability of primary care physicians, specialists, and screening programs is crucial.
* **Availability of wellness programs:** Smoking cessation programs, fitness classes, and health education initiatives can empower residents to make healthy choices.
* **Outdoor recreation opportunities:** Parks, trails, and green spaces encourage physical activity and reduce stress.
* **Educational attainment:** Higher levels of education are often associated with greater health awareness and access to information.
